Helical piles (also called helical anchors, helical piers, screw piles, etc.) are not only useful in foundation repair, they can be used pre-construction to ensure a stable foundation. Unlike "push" piers, pre-construction helical piers are torque-driven, which does not require the resistance weight of an existing structure. Once driven to the target capacity, a pile cap is installed, giving a flat, solid surface upon which a footing or slab may be poured.
